I have a c&c x mag,been useing it for 6 months now.On hybrid mode its the fastest thing on the planet other than full auto,some tournies dont like it in that mode as they call it trigger bounce,as for it being the fastest on straight semi,cant say its any faster than most other topp end electros.Still a good marker & totally reliable.:) :) :)

speak to John or Jackie Sosta at Powerpulse 01206 240831 they will sort you with the best price and even better support!

John actually makes the C&C X-mag in the UK andthen ships them to the states, so yes the best deal is from John. also the Yanks have a massive backorder from john, so you would have to wait for ages for one over the pond, whereas John keeps UK sales seperate, and can probably turn one around (depending on the anodising job you want) in about a month. fully built and tested my the man himself. have a look on their website http://www.airgun.com/Europe/index.html for more details.
